About Ratton Wood

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

Ratton Wood is a detached house in Eastbourne (BN20 9AE). It has a recorded floor area of 542 m² (around 5834 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band H. The latest certificate (November 2023) shows a D (score 56), a step below the typical UK home.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 75).

At 542 m² the property is well over the postcode median (159 m² across 11 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. It changed hands recently, sold September 2025 for £1,900,000. Today's modelled estimate of £2,177,000 is 14.6% above the 2025 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£326/sq ft) was about 18.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
